Who needs a bylaw of form?
01
Non-profit organizations: Non-profit organizations typically require a bylaw form to establish their internal operating rules, procedures, and governance structure.
02
Corporations: Corporations, especially those with multiple shareholders or directors, often need a bylaw form to outline the rights, responsibilities, and decision-making processes within the organization.
03
Community associations: Community associations, such as homeowner associations or neighborhood associations, may require a bylaw form to establish rules, membership criteria, and dispute resolution procedures.
04
Professional associations: Professional associations often use a bylaw form to define membership requirements, ethical standards, and guidelines for professional conduct.
05
Foundations and trusts: Foundations and trusts may use a bylaw form to outline their purpose, grant-making processes, and rules for managing assets and distributing funds.
